Exciting things are happening in our Electrical Technologies program! Our students are currently hard at work wiring Magnetic Motor Starters with timer relays. These hands-on skills are essential for a successful career in the electrical field. Great job!

Branch Area Careers Center hosted “College Day” on Tuesday September 24, where students were exposed to a range of post high school opportunities. College Day featured 43 colleges, universities, trade schools, and military representatives, providing a diverse range of options for students to explore. The event was made possible by the dedicated efforts of the Branch Area Careers Center team and Kellogg Community College.
